Fast, friendly service, large portions and the biggest beer I've ever seen!
Despite the review down below, I find their salsa to be very tasty, so much so that my buddy's girlfriend buys it by the caraffe!
Great place to go for lunch when you are pressed for time. Gets a bit crowded, but not to the point where you have to wait for a table.
The chicken quesadillas here are very good.
In the evenings, the small bar area at the back left of the restaurant is a lively little place to grab a beer or margaritaville and watch some futbol on the television.
Monterrey's doesn't reinvent the wheel when it comes to mexican restaurants, but it does what it does very well, and has become one of my favorites in the area.
